Seoul Garden | Amazing Food
Sign In
Seoul Garden
Seoul Garden
5270 Pearl Rd, Cleveland, OH 44129
(216) 661-5990
5 dishes
5
Menu Items
0.0
Average Rating
N/A
Price Range
Filters
Filters
Loading dishes...
Sign In